The Scotwaste Monarchs ran riot with a 58-34 win at Glasgow on Sunday afternoon, resoundingly taking us through to the semi-finals of the Premier Trophy.

We are becoming used to these seven-man high quality displays and that was what we saw again at Ashfield. However there has to be a special mention for no. 7 Aaron Summers who scored a paid maximum, completing it in an incredible heat 14.

In this heat Aaron had to go off 15 metres after touching the tapes. On a dusty track it seemed his maximum would be lost (he had won three earlier heats) but with a great display of skill he drove between Dicken and Grajczonek to take a paid win.

It was success all the way. We scored 7 5-1 heat wins, 10 race wins (everyone had at least one) and didn't even need any finishers after heat 11 to win the match.

For Glasgow Shane Parker won 5 heats and took 4 points on a TS ride, but he was pretty well alone. Regrettably Trent Leverington was ruled out after hitting the fence in heat 1 while racing Ryan Fisher out of the second bend. This certainly cost Glasgow points.

However the public comments of Stewart Dickson suggested that changes may not be far away for his team.

For Edinburgh at the moment the only real problem is avoiding sky-high expectations.
